    National Train Day was a holiday started by Amtrak in 2008 as a way to spread information about the advantages of traveling by Train in the United States. Most of the activities/celebrations of this holiday are held in Amtrak's major stations as well as in museums. There are Amtrak Acela sets and Keystone trains displayed in parts of the Northeast United States and you will have superliner cars in Florida, San Antonio Texas and Los Angeles along with private train cars. Some rail compaines and freight companies in major U.S cities have certain displays of their trains and ways of celebrating National Train Day in the U.S as well but it's mainly celebrated by Amtrak.
